Pink 1,000 mg Vitamin C Pink Lemonade
About This Product
Emergen-C Pink 1,000 mg Vitamin C Pink Lemonade is a longevity and NAD+ category supplement providing a blend of vitamins and minerals. It contains 21 ingredients, with Vitamin C at a robust 1000 mg, Niacin at 5 mg, Vitamin B6 at 10 mg, Vitamin B12 at 25 mcg, and Pantothenic Acid at 2.5 mg, all present at clinical doses. However, Thiamine, Riboflavin, and Folic Acid are underdosed according to current research. This product received an N+ Score of 56, earning an 'F' grade, indicating significant room for improvement in formulation despite 100% label transparency. The low score is primarily due to an ingredient adequacy of 27% and formula completeness of 25%. This product might be considered by individuals seeking a high dose of Vitamin C and certain B vitamins, but should be aware of the underdosed components.

Ingredient Analysis (21 ingredients)
| Ingredient | Amount | Status |
|---|---|---|
| Calories | 25.000 {Calories} | N/A |
| Thiamine | 0.380 mg | Under |
| Riboflavin | 0.430 mg | Under |
| Niacin | 5.000 mg | Adequate |
| Vitamin B6 | 10.000 mg | Optimal |
| Vitamin B12 | 25.000 mcg | Optimal |
| Pantothenic Acid | 2.500 mg | Adequate |
| Vitamin C | 1000.000 mg | Optimal |
| Calcium | 50.000 mg | Under |
| Magnesium | 60.000 mg | Under |
| Zinc | 2.000 mg | Under |
| Manganese | 0.500 mg | Under |
| Chromium | 10.000 mcg | Under |
| Total Carbohydrates | 6.000 g | N/A |
| Folic Acid | 12.500 mcg | Under |
| Sodium | 60.000 mg | N/A |
| Potassium | 200.000 mg | Under |
| Alpha Lipoic Acid | 1.000 mg | N/A |
| Quercetin | 1.000 mg | N/A |
| Phosphorus | 38.000 mg | Under |
| Monk Fruit | 10.000 mg | N/A |
Clinical ranges based on NIH ODS Fact Sheets and peer-reviewed research. Status indicates whether the amount meets evidence-based thresholds.
